The Piltriquitrón
mountain (“hanging from the clouds” in Mapuche language)
“The
Piltri” (2,260 meters over sea level) is said to have strong positive energy
which deeply influences the inhabitants of the area. Its forests of
cypresses and cohiues, together with the buckthorns and a variety of bushes
and wild flowers, profusely cover the mountainside. In the fall, the ochre,
golden and orange tones contrast with the wide range of greens found in the
summer. In winter the snow covered mountain tops and in spring/fall the
burst of colors from the flowerbeds make this one of the most visited places
in the area.
There is a way up leading off from route 40, 3 km from El
Bolsón’s ACA.
It’s a gravel road which skirts the mountain until it arrives at the
mountain shelter, passing through the “carved wood” and the “pampita” (small
plain) where the paragliders jump from.
El Bolsón
El
Bolsón is the most important center of the Andean Region of Parallel 42,
made up by villages in Rio Negro and Chubut provinces. It is located in Rio
Negro, 126 km from Bariloche.
Apart
from its typical Patagonian architecture, vast number of trees and flowers,
El Bolsón has various banks, supermarkets and all types of shops.
It is
internationally known for its arts and crafts fair which can be found right
in the center of the town.

Cabeza de Indio (Indian
Head)
This is
another “must” place to visit and does not take more than half a day. It is
a course in the valley made by the old bed of the Azul river which carved
out the faces of the native people in the rocks. A peaceful walk in this
circuit allows you to fully appreciate the thick mantle of autochthonous
vegetation and the rocks worn by the river.

Skiing and
snowboard slopes on Mount Perito Moreno
Twenty kilometers away
from the center of El Bolsón, going towards Mallín Ahogado, there is
a skiing center which includes a shelter and ski lifts. There are
slopes for all kinds of skiers from beginners up to the highly
experienced, with the possibility of skiing through a breathtaking
forest. There is a view of the valley and you can enjoy it summer
and winter as the shelter remains open all year round. You can rent
skiing equipment, sledges, skis and snowboards.
Lago Puelo (Lake Puelo)
One of
the most beautiful lakes in Patagonia. Its shores are made up of stone or
sand, interpretative pathways (Bosque de las Sombras (Shadow Wood), Pitranto
Grande and Pitranto Chico) and the most amazingly transparent water. On
board the Juana de Arco it is possible to reach the point which marks the
boundary with Chile as well as visit exceptional places. By this means one
reaches one of the three places in the world where you can appreciate the “Valdivian
jungle” with its unique characteristics. Its
strange flora and fauna include marsupials (miniature monkeys) and
vegetation which includes giant ferns in the lowest pass of the southern
mountain range.
